What is the most important thing in life?

"Money", he replied.




Let me explain how this came about. Rewind...

Every Friday I volunteer at a local Soup Kitchen where I serve food for people that might not have the means to buy food. It's a great experience and I recommend it to everyone!

So I was walking around serving coffee and I noticed that one man was talking to another volunteer. She was a teenager, still in school. I heard him ask her "what is the most important thing in life?" To which she replied without hesitation "Happiness". The man then mockingly rolled his eyes and said "happiness...pfff".
"No, the most important thing in life is money", he told her. "Without money, there is nothing you can do and you will be miserable".

I continued walking along and went to serve coffee at other tables.

Later that night, I recalled this incident. It had stuck with me. It was interesting to see that this man, who probably did not have a lot of money, had a different view on the 'important' things in life, depending on his situation. So it is very subjective. Interesting...
